What colors go well with #B7F9B3?

The complementary color is HSL(297, 86%, 84%). For a triadic harmony, use hues 117°, 237°, and 357°. For analogous combinations, try hues 87° and 147°. See the Color Harmony section above for complete palettes with previews.
